Particle
.news
International Relations
❯
Russia-Ukraine Conflict
❯
Naval Warfare
❯
Arrest Warrant
ICC
1 ARTICLES
last yr.
Russia Dismisses Navy Chief Amid Ukraine's Successful Black Sea Campaign